TikTok and PUBG Called Illegitimate by Taliban, to Be Banned in Afghanistan in Next Three Months

18th September, 2022 · admin

8am: The Taliban-controlled ministry decided to ban the use of TikTok and PUBG in a meeting attended by representatives of the Taliban’s security sectors and the Ministry of Virtue Promotion. According to the decision of the Taliban’s Ministry of Communications and Information Technology, TikTok will be banned in Afghanistan within one month and PUBG after three months.
